Livio Bieri
|
ca44a913c9
|
wip: session group statistics w/ permission
|
2023-10-24 12:05:55 +02:00 |
Reto Aebersold
|
577746bff1
|
fix: filter feedback users
|
2023-10-19 15:52:37 +02:00 |
Livio Bieri
|
500a376877
|
fix: filter out feedback
experts that might have submitted just for testing -> should not be
included in the feedback results / API
|
2023-10-12 15:55:35 +02:00 |
Daniel Egger
|
966533e13b
|
Add feedback trainer cypress test
|
2023-09-26 18:48:25 +02:00 |
Daniel Egger
|
66b50d6b1d
|
Refactor feedback response creation
|
2023-09-26 18:13:33 +02:00 |
Daniel Egger
|
89e068fb09
|
Add cypress test for student
|
2023-09-26 14:34:22 +02:00 |
Daniel Egger
|
7a037e05ec
|
Remove automatic feedback creation in prepare scripts
|
2023-09-26 13:43:44 +02:00 |
Daniel Egger
|
0444658ce3
|
Fix unit tests
|
2023-09-26 13:43:44 +02:00 |
Daniel Egger
|
733063399f
|
VBV-525: Feedback can only be sent once per person
|
2023-09-26 13:43:44 +02:00 |
Daniel Egger
|
70655935b0
|
VBV-525: Refactor feedback submission
|
2023-09-26 13:43:44 +02:00 |
Daniel Egger
|
d80400ea8c
|
VBV-525: Fix feedback data rest endpoint
|
2023-09-26 13:43:44 +02:00 |
Daniel Egger
|
cff3d6e49b
|
Fix unit test
|
2023-09-08 16:25:33 +02:00 |
Daniel Egger
|
da56f2a346
|
Refactor Notification model
|
2023-08-30 18:47:36 +02:00 |
Daniel Egger
|
d83f660918
|
Change email function to use email address directly
|
2023-08-29 14:31:21 +02:00 |
Elia Bieri
|
56e454cc8b
|
Squash merge of code from Elia
|
2023-08-29 14:31:18 +02:00 |
Daniel Egger
|
9f8686e592
|
Improve django admin
|
2023-08-23 19:06:32 +02:00 |
Christian Cueni
|
81351aa9fa
|
Exclude email, fix dates, don't check "Geburtsdatum" field
|
2023-08-17 14:41:47 +02:00 |
Christian Cueni
|
6195c9d32a
|
Use page id for feedbacks, filter by course session id
|
2023-08-14 19:57:31 +02:00 |
Christian Cueni
|
a411cc82d1
|
Fix missing "contact trainer"-functionality
|
2023-08-14 18:04:35 +02:00 |
Christian Cueni
|
406cf425c2
|
Enable FeedbackResponses in admin
|
2023-08-14 17:27:23 +02:00 |
Daniel Egger
|
e8178fa36a
|
Format code
|
2023-07-14 17:14:00 +02:00 |
Daniel Egger
|
e208fdabbc
|
Change after making UUIDs
|
2023-07-14 17:13:21 +02:00 |
Daniel Egger
|
5ed883e83b
|
Use UUIDs as primary key for models with user context
|
2023-07-14 14:37:59 +02:00 |
Daniel Egger
|
7c2190feaa
|
Reset migrations
|
2023-07-14 14:16:38 +02:00 |
Daniel Egger
|
31dae0a5cd
|
VBV-306: Use GraphQL for assignment code
|
2023-05-15 19:07:06 +02:00 |
Daniel Egger
|
a15af2bf86
|
VBV-350: Refactor LearningContent to individual wagtail pages
|
2023-05-12 11:51:02 +02:00 |
Christian Cueni
|
6534cbf8df
|
Update feedback questions and order
|
2023-05-09 14:38:40 +02:00 |
Daniel Egger
|
c0dc4d6a2f
|
Fix python tests
|
2023-04-14 10:02:33 +02:00 |
Daniel Egger
|
8d41d3d3a2
|
VBV-193 refactored course completion for course sessions
|
2023-03-31 18:27:47 +02:00 |
Christian Cueni
|
442e04dfe3
|
Merge branch 'develop'
|
2023-02-13 09:36:50 +01:00 |
Elia Bieri
|
b5e4c30d40
|
Merged in feature/notifications (pull request #15)
|
2023-02-08 11:39:27 +00:00 |
Christian Cueni
|
aa5b744285
|
Migrate form data to json field
|
2023-02-06 16:03:40 +01:00 |
Christian Cueni
|
23fd945cb6
|
Fix test, lint vue
|
2023-01-31 08:26:16 +01:00 |
Christian Cueni
|
bd3388714e
|
Fix UI errors
|
2023-01-31 08:26:16 +01:00 |
Christian Cueni
|
2ab8f580bc
|
Add HorizontalBar component
|
2023-01-31 08:26:16 +01:00 |
Christian Cueni
|
b7038c1a9c
|
Add open feedback component, update vertical bar chart
|
2023-01-31 08:26:16 +01:00 |
Christian Cueni
|
ec58ca176c
|
Add basic Feedback page
|
2023-01-31 08:26:15 +01:00 |
Christian Cueni
|
44ed154814
|
Add summary component
|
2023-01-31 08:26:15 +01:00 |
Christian Cueni
|
88848aa292
|
WIP: Add single feedback endpoint
|
2023-01-31 08:26:15 +01:00 |
Christian Cueni
|
46710d29b9
|
Add summary endpoint
|
2023-01-31 08:26:15 +01:00 |
Christian Cueni
|
276cd20e99
|
Use dynamic medialibrary link
|
2023-01-11 13:45:42 +01:00 |
Ramon Wenger
|
1a8024e789
|
Add missing migration
|
2023-01-11 10:44:22 +01:00 |
Ramon Wenger
|
f58b2f6303
|
Format python code according to ufmt
|
2022-12-29 16:32:50 +01:00 |
Ramon Wenger
|
9d848c3f9b
|
Add course session to feedback model
|
2022-12-29 16:29:13 +01:00 |
Ramon Wenger
|
c64bc463db
|
Make formatter happy
|
2022-12-29 16:28:36 +01:00 |
Ramon Wenger
|
44599d455c
|
Replace deprecated fields
|
2022-12-29 16:26:31 +01:00 |
Ramon Wenger
|
5e559b66b0
|
Update Feedback model, add Wagtail block
|
2022-12-29 16:26:31 +01:00 |
Ramon Wenger
|
6a2859e641
|
Swap serializer mutation for form mutation
|
2022-12-29 16:20:20 +01:00 |
Ramon Wenger
|
e1d9df7d31
|
Add initial implementation of feedback form
|
2022-12-29 16:20:20 +01:00 |